Giving Tuesday, November 28th 2017, marked the official launch of the

Diamond Daughter Corporation.

Over 50 people came together to celebrate this momentous event!

Cedar Creek Catering brought warmth to all the attendees with delicious appetizers and hot apple cider. Delia Renee Photography buzzed through the crowd, snapping pictures and making everyone feel like a star. The ambiance of WeWork was welcoming with a relaxed vibe, that allowed everyone to feel right at home. The successful people of Philadelphia were glowing as they came together to network and encourage each other through the mission and understanding of DDC.

A presentation was given by our founder Angela Deery, outlining the vision and driving force behind DDC. “DDC is committed to lifting the head of every lady in the city and letting them know their value goes far beyond any blemish, circumstance or failure. DDC will focus on reassuring ladies of all ages, their purpose in life was never meant to squeeze into a model mold or be explained by TMZ. We want confidence to be found not in keeping up with the Kardashians or Jones, but within your own path, your own body and even in your own imperfections. Because we believe, that’s where the true beauty is found.”

She then went on to introduce the backbone of this vision; the members of the board:

Audrey Dellagranda, Kerri-Ann Buchanan, Tina Olive, Darcel Laurie, Lorisa Green-Depte, Mia Hollingsworth and Jennifer Ingram.

The highlight of the night was when 6 young ladies, from the first Diamond Daughter Course, spoke about their experience . The crowd felt empowered hearing the stories of how lessons of fashion, etiquette and power posing led these ladies to feel united and most of all free to fully express their genuine selves.

Afterwards attendees flocked to the Donation Table and the DDC in Your Community to be involved in multiple ways: financially, volunteering and ideas for future programs.

The night ended with the Diamond Daughter Necklace being raffled off to winner Jam Smith, who beamed as she was crowned with her prize.

The overall response was heartfelt and yearning for more, from all who participated.
